Zoey goes to a store an buys an item that costs x dollars. She has a coupon for 15% off, and then a 9% tax is added to the disco
pshichka [43]

Answer:

0.9265x

Step-by-step explanation:

x - 0.15x + 0.09(0.85x)

x is the initial amount, -0.15x is subtracting 15% of the original amount (leaving 0.85x), and 0.09(0.85x) is the 9% tax.

Simplified:

x - 0.15x + 0.09(0.85x)

= 0.85x + 0.0765x

= 0.9265x

Begin by using Pythagorean theorem to solve for the length of the diagonal of the base:

a² + b² = c²

Use the length and width in the equation:

8² + 3² = c²

64 + 9 = c²

73 = c²

c ≈ 8.54 cm

Now, we can find the length of the diagonal of the prism using our calculated diagonal of the base and the height. Use the same equation:

(8.54)² + 7² = c²

73 + 49 = c²

122 = c²

√122 = c

c = 11.05 ≈ 11 cm. The correct answer is B.
